Overcoming Regulatory Hurdles

Regulatory compliance in pharmaceutical returns and recalls is a challenging landscape, especially when managing varying regulations across different regions. Abhishek has consistently prioritized meeting these complex demands while promoting sustainability. "Each market has its own stringent requirements for handling returns and recalls, particularly concerning the safe disposal of products and preventing counterfeit drugs from re-entering the supply chain," he explains.

To address these challenges, Abhishek implemented strategies that streamlined the returns process, ensuring that every step adhered to regulatory standards while minimizing environmental impact. His approach involved safely repurposing or responsibly disposing of returned products, which not only complied with regulations but also set new standards for sustainable practices in the industry. By aligning strict regulatory compliance with sustainability goals, Abhishek has pioneered solutions that drive both efficiency and responsibility within the pharmaceutical supply chain.

Balancing Costs with Long-Term Gains

Balancing short-term costs with long-term sustainability benefits is a common challenge, but Abhishek has shown that sustainability initiatives can drive both ethical and financial success. "One of the key strategies I use is to present sustainability initiatives as drivers of efficiency and innovation," he explains, highlighting how these practices reduce waste, lower energy consumption, and streamline processes, ultimately leading to significant cost savings over time. Additionally, he emphasizes how sustainability can improve a company's reputation and open new markets focused on environmentally responsible products.

Abhishek's leadership in revamping a returns process that handled 70,000 claims annually, valued at $2 billion, is a clear example of this. By automating workflows and improving pricing methods, he reduced processing times from 7–10 days to under three days, increased customer satisfaction from 85% to over 95%, and saved the company $10 million annually. These outcomes demonstrate the financial and operational benefits of adopting sustainable practices, proving that long-term thinking can deliver substantial returns in a business environment focused on short-term gains.
